Salary Range & Percentiles
Pay distribution across experience levels
10th Percentile — Entry Level$63,705
25th Percentile — Junior$82,781
50th Percentile — Median$96,482
75th Percentile — Senior$125,702
90th Percentile — Top Earners$141,971
